Преглед изворни кода

Adds cross region info to jitsiRegionInfo.

master
damencho пре 9 година
родитељ
комит
40c0c622ee
1 измењених фајлова са 6 додато и 6 уклоњено
  1. 6
    6
      connection_optimization/external_connect.js

+ 6
- 6
connection_optimization/external_connect.js Прегледај датотеку

40
                 try {
40
                 try {
41
                     var data = JSON.parse(xhttp.responseText);
41
                     var data = JSON.parse(xhttp.responseText);
42
 
42
 
43
+                    var proxyRegion = xhttp.getResponseHeader('X-Proxy-Region');
44
+                    var jitsiRegion = xhttp.getResponseHeader('X-Jitsi-Region');
43
                     window.jitsiRegionInfo = {
45
                     window.jitsiRegionInfo = {
44
-                        "ProxyRegion" :
45
-                            xhttp.getResponseHeader('X-Proxy-Region'),
46
-                        "Region" :
47
-                            xhttp.getResponseHeader('X-Jitsi-Region'),
48
-                        "Shard" :
49
-                            xhttp.getResponseHeader('X-Jitsi-Shard')
46
+                        "ProxyRegion" : proxyRegion,
47
+                        "Region" : jitsiRegion,
48
+                        "Shard" : xhttp.getResponseHeader('X-Jitsi-Shard'),
49
+                        "CrossRegion": proxyRegion !== jitsiRegion ? 1 : 0
50
                     };
50
                     };
51
 
51
 
52
                     success_callback(data);
52
                     success_callback(data);

Loading…
Откажи
Сачувај